I love OHP but I love behind the neck presses even more. I switched about 2 years ago and so far what I noticed- bigger triceps(long head), more trap activation, easy to spot(catch in squat position), better mobility gains and no loss of strength when trying standard OHP. @noahtm75303 ай бұрын
if youre gonna do that then put less weight and dont use the bands.. that defeats the whole purpose of the squat..
@Swoleseph3 ай бұрын
Not really. It allows you to use heavier weight and your CNS becomes adapted to it. Thus progressing you into using that same weight without the bands. Or you could do reps without the bands and then once you fatigue you can use the bands to force out more.
